Output ed7e08e9d7cfa62bbfef2fec4d1cd4e4c9384283a15852eb040f2d7d9cd2937c:1

value
74632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a4a399d08c59932accbc26b5aae2fcd31751e7 OP_EQUAL
address
3MFwkvDQi4qnkDJaeaTQgtXACdheLu6Ahy
transaction
ed7e08e9d7cfa62bbfef2fec4d1cd4e4c9384283a15852eb040f2d7d9cd2937c
confirmations
242152
spent
true